Comprehending the Railroad-Asthma Connection
The association in between railroads and asthma is multifaceted, encompassing both occupational and ecological aspects. Let's explore the crucial elements:
1. Occupational Hazards for Railroad Workers:
For those used in the railroad industry, the danger of establishing asthma and other breathing illnesses is significantly raised due to direct exposure to a variety of hazardous substances. These occupational risks include:
- Diesel Exhaust: Diesel locomotives, the workhorses of modern rail transport, discharge an intricate mixture of gases and particulate matter. Diesel exhaust particles are known asthma activates, capable of triggering air passage inflammation and worsening pre-existing breathing conditions. Employees in yards, maintenance centers, and even locomotive engineers in older models deal with considerable exposure.
- Asbestos: Historically, asbestos was thoroughly utilized in engines, rail cars, and infrastructure for insulation and fireproofing. Railroad employees, especially mechanics, carmen, and those included in demolition or repair, were exposed to asbestos fibers. Asbestos is a reputable cause of lung illness, consisting of asbestosis, lung cancer, and mesothelioma cancer, but it can likewise add to asthma and respiratory tract irritation.
- Silica Dust: Track upkeep and construction activities create significant amounts of silica dust, specifically during ballast handling and grinding operations. Breathing in crystalline silica can lead to silicosis, a severe lung illness, and can likewise irritate the respiratory tracts, making people more susceptible to asthma and other breathing problems.
- Coal Dust: In the age of steam locomotives and even in contemporary coal transport, coal dust exposure has actually been and continues to be a concern. Breathing in coal dust can trigger coal employee's pneumoconiosis ("black lung") and add to chronic bronchitis and asthma.
- Creosote and Wood Preservatives: Creosote, a preservative used to deal with wood railroad ties, releases volatile organic substances (VOCs) and polycyclic aromatic hydrocarbons (PAHs). These chemicals are respiratory irritants and possible asthma triggers. Workers handling cured ties or working in areas where creosote is utilized may be exposed.
- Welding Fumes: Welding is a typical practice in railroad repair and maintenance. Welding fumes include metal particles and gases that can aggravate the respiratory system and contribute to asthma development, especially in welders and those operating in distance to welding activities.
- Mold and Biological Agents: In damp or poorly aerated railway environments, mold growth can occur, releasing spores that are potent allergens and asthma triggers.
2. Environmental Impacts on Residents Near Railroads:
Beyond occupational risks, living near railroad tracks or freight backyards can also increase the danger of asthma and breathing problems due to ecological contamination:
- Air Pollution from Trains: Train operations, specifically in freight yards and heavily trafficked corridors, contribute to local air pollution. Diesel exhaust from engines, together with particulate matter from brake dust and the resuspension of track debris, can break down air quality and exacerbate asthma in close-by communities, especially impacting children and the elderly.
- Noise Pollution: While not straight triggering asthma, chronic noise contamination from trains can contribute to stress and sleep disruptions, which can indirectly affect immune function and possibly make people more vulnerable to respiratory diseases or exacerbate status quo.
- Distance to Industrial Sites: Railroads frequently run through or near commercial areas, freight yards, and railyards. These places can be sources of extra air toxins, including commercial emissions and fugitive dust, which can further contribute to breathing problems in surrounding property areas.
The Legal Landscape and Settlements
Acknowledging the destructive health impacts related to railroad work and living environments, impacted people have actually looked for legal option to obtain visit this website link settlement for their Full Statement suffering and medical costs. The legal landscape in Railroad Settlement Emphysema the United States, Railroad Settlement Esophageal Cancer especially worrying railroad Railroad Cancer Settlement worker health, is often governed by the Federal Employers Liability Act (FELA).
FELA, unlike state employees' compensation laws, permits railroad employees to sue their employers for negligence if they can show that their company's carelessness triggered their injury or disease. This has actually been an important avenue for railroad workers struggling with asthma and other breathing diseases to seek settlements from railroad companies.
Settlements in railroad asthma cases typically involve demonstrating a direct link between the worker's exposure to hazardous compounds and the advancement or worsening of their asthma. This can be complicated and needs medical documentation, expert testimony, and typically, historical records of working conditions and possible exposures at specific railroad sites.
For citizens living near railways, legal avenues for settlements are frequently less specified and might involve environmental tort claims or class-action lawsuits versus railroad companies or responsible celebrations for environmental contamination. These cases can be challenging, requiring extensive clinical proof to develop a direct causal link between railroad-related pollution and asthma in a specific community.
Ongoing Concerns and Mitigation Efforts
While awareness of the health threats related to railroads and asthma has grown, and guidelines have actually been carried out in some locations, concerns stay. Modern diesel locomotives are usually cleaner than older designs, and some railroads are exploring alternative fuels and innovations to decrease emissions. Nevertheless, tradition pollution from previous practices and ongoing direct exposures in specific occupations still posture risks.
Efforts to alleviate the effect of railroads on asthma consist of:
- Improved Ventilation and Respiratory Protection: In occupational settings, implementing much better ventilation systems in maintenance centers and providing respirators to employees exposed to dust, diesel exhaust, and other air-borne threats can lower exposure levels.
- Emission Reduction Technologies: Railroad companies are embracing cleaner diesel motor, exploring alternative fuels like biofuels and hydrogen, and executing innovations like diesel particulate filters to lower emissions.
- Ecological Monitoring and Regulations: Increased tracking of air quality near railway lines and stricter ecological regulations for railroad operations can assist secure communities from pollution.
- Land Use Planning and Buffer Zones: Urban planning that incorporates buffer zones between suburbs and significant railway lines or freight yards can assist lessen exposure to sound and air contamination.
- Medical Surveillance and Early Detection: Implementing medical security programs for railroad employees and locals in high-risk locations can assist detect respiratory problems early and help with prompt intervention and treatment.

Frequently Asked Questions (FAQs)
Q1: What are the main substances in the railroad environment that can set off asthma?
A1: Key asthma triggers in the railroad environment consist of diesel exhaust, asbestos fibers, silica dust, coal dust, creosote fumes, welding fumes, and mold spores.
Q2: Are all railroad workers at danger of developing asthma?
A2: While all railroad employees may face some level of exposure, those in specific occupations such as mechanics, carmen, track upkeep workers, backyard workers, and engineers (especially in older engines) are at greater danger due to more direct and extended exposure to harmful substances.
Q3: Can living near railroad tracks trigger asthma?
A3: Yes, studies have actually shown that living near hectic railway lines or freight backyards can increase the risk of asthma, particularly in children and susceptible populations, due to air contamination from diesel exhaust and particulate matter.
Q4: What is FELA, and how does it relate to railroad employee asthma?
A4: FELA (Federal Employers Liability Act) is a federal law that enables railroad workers to sue their companies for negligence if they are injured on the job, consisting of developing diseases like asthma due to harmful working conditions.
Q5: What kind of settlements can railroad workers with asthma receive?
A5: Settlements can vary extensively depending upon the seriousness of the asthma, the level of direct exposure, medical expenditures, lost salaries, and the strength of proof showing the causal link in between railroad work and asthma. Settlements can cover medical expenses, lost income, discomfort and suffering, and other damages.
Q6: Are there any regulations in location to safeguard railroad employees and communities from asthma-causing contaminants?
A6: Yes, there are policies from agencies like OSHA (Occupational Safety and Health Administration) and EPA (Environmental Protection Agency) that aim to restrict direct exposure to hazardous compounds in the office and the environment. However, enforcement and effectiveness can differ, and ongoing advocacy is needed to enhance defenses.
Q7: What can be done to minimize the threat of railroad-related asthma?
A7: Risk decrease measures consist of:
- Using cleaner engine technologies and fuels.
- Improving ventilation and breathing security for employees.
- Executing dust control measures throughout track maintenance.
- Monitoring air quality near trains.
- Producing buffer zones between railways and domestic areas.
- Promoting medical security and early detection of respiratory issues.
Q8: If I live near railroad tracks and think my asthma is associated, what should I do?
A8: Consult with a medical professional and inform them about your residential proximity to the railway. Keep records of your symptoms, nearby railroad activities, and any air quality information available. You can also research regional environmental companies or legal resources if you think ecological contamination from the railway is adding to your health issues.
